April is the perfect time to bring seasonal learning into the classroom, and this April Showers Bring May Flowers folded craft printable makes it both meaningful and fun.

April Showers Bring May Flowers folded craft printable with umbrella rain scene and colorful spring flowers reveal

With its interactive design, kids get to explore the classic spring saying and create a colorful craft that reveals a hidden scene: rainy clouds on the outside and blooming flowers on the inside.

This hands-on activity is ideal for preschool, kindergarten, and early elementary students, helping them connect weather patterns to seasonal changes in a simple, visual way.

Step-by-step instructions

Print the template on white paper.

color the printable

Color the design using crayons, markers, or colored pencils.

cut out the template

Carefully cut out the template.

fold

Fold the template in half, aligning:

   – the line under “April Showers”

   – with the line under “Bring May Flowers”

Press firmly along the fold.
